Why Smart Thermostat Wiring Matters More Than You Think
Installing a smart thermostat sounds simple, but behind the sleek exterior lies complex wiring that plays a major role in your HVAC system’s performance. When people try to DIY their setups, mismatched wires, incompatible voltage levels, or missing C-wires lead to costly mistakes—or worse, damage to the system. This is where a professional Smart Thermostat Wiring Service becomes a game-changer.
Smart thermostats like Nest, Ecobee, or Honeywell require precise wiring to sync with your home’s heating and cooling. Most importantly, they need a continuous power supply to stay online—something traditional thermostats didn’t depend upon. As a result, upgrading to smart tech requires proper evaluation of your electrical setup.

Common Challenges Fixed by Smart Thermostat Wiring Service
A major challenge homeowners face is the missing C-wire. Without it, smart thermostats lose power or reboot randomly. In some homes, connecting the wrong wire (like accidentally linking the fan wire as a power source) causes HVAC units to behave erratically, turning on and off without command. These issues can be prevented with expert help.
For example, one customer installed their Nest thermostat using a YouTube video. However, their heating stopped working come winter. Our technician discovered that while the thermostat seemed to work, it wasn’t sending the correct heat signal due to a miswired common line. After correcting the wiring and adding a proper C-wire adapter, the system ran smoothly again.

Wired vs Wireless Installations—Which Is Better?
Some homeowners ask whether they can skip traditional wiring entirely by using battery-powered or wireless alternatives. While attractive, these options come with limitations. Wireless thermostats often rely on short-range communication and batteries that die fast in high-power systems.
Wired installations are not only more reliable, but they also enable richer features like voice integration with Alexa or Google Assistant, energy usage reports, and compatibility with multi-speed HVAC systems. Consequently, they’re the preferred choice for long-term efficiency.

FAQs About Smart Thermostat Wiring
Q: Do all homes need new wiring for a smart thermostat?
A: Not always. Some homes already have compatible wiring, but older systems usually need updates like a C-wire or adapter.
Q: What is a C-wire and why is it so important?
A: The C-wire, or common wire, supplies continuous power to smart thermostats. Without it, devices may lose connection or reset randomly.
Q: How long does a Smart Thermostat Wiring Service take?
A: Typically, about 1 to 2 hours, depending on the home’s wiring complexity and whether a new wire needs to be added.

Expert Tip: Match the Thermostat to Your System
Not all thermostats are compatible with every HVAC system. For example, heat pump systems with auxiliary heat require thermostats that can handle multiple stages and emergency settings. Similarly, older oil furnaces may not support common wiring without additional transformers.
That’s why tailored Smart Thermostat Wiring Service often starts with your system specs before touching the thermostat itself. One size definitely doesn’t fit all here.
